Eastman Kodak Company v. Robinson
Eastman Kodak Company v. Robinson is a federal trademark lawsuit filed on 01/19/2005 in the District Court, W.D. New York. The case was terminated on 07/25/2005.

About Trademark Lawsuits
Trademark lawsuits allege infringement or dilution of a brand name, logo, or other mark under the Lanham Act — typically claims that one party's use is likely to confuse consumers about the source of goods or services.
